Introduction
Exploration is a core part of Minecraft, leading you to various structures with hidden treasures and dangers. One of the most significant structures you’ll seek is the stronghold. Strongholds are large, maze-like structures hidden deep underground in the Overworld dimension. They are crucial because they contain the End portal, which is the only way to travel to the End dimension and face the Ender Dragon. While you can technically find a stronghold through pure luck, the intended and most reliable method involves using a specific item: the Eye of Ender.

How to Find a Stronghold Using Eyes of Ender
The primary way to locate a stronghold in a survival world without cheats is by using Eyes of Ender.
Crafting an Eye of Ender
To make an Eye of Ender, you need two ingredients: an Ender pearl and blaze powder. You can craft them in a crafting table or directly in your inventory crafting interface. Use a 1:1 ratio—one Ender pearl and one blaze powder.
Ender Pearls

Dropped by Endermen when defeated. Endermen can be found in the Overworld at night or in certain Nether biomes. Looking directly at one or attacking it will make it hostile and cause it to teleport toward you.
Blaze Powder

Crafted from Blaze Rods, which drop from Blazes found in Nether fortresses. Blazes shoot fireballs and often spawn near blaze spawners.
You’ll need several Eyes of Ender to find a stronghold and activate the portal. Some may break when used.

Village Link


In Bedrock Edition, strongholds have a tendency to generate underneath villages. This is especially true for the first three strongholds generated, which are at least 453 blocks away from the world origin (0,0) and tend to be near village meeting points. You can sometimes find a stronghold by digging beneath a village, particularly one found relatively close to spawn (e.g., within 1000 blocks of 0,0 on both coordinates). However, this isn’t guaranteed and may not work for all villages or strongholds further out.

Inside the Stronghold: Exploration and Hazards
Strongholds are maze-like underground structures made of various stone bricks.
Navigation

Use torches on one side of walls (e.g., left) to help track your path. Breaking doors as you pass can also help mark explored paths.
Rooms
Libraries

Contain bookshelves, cobwebs, and chests with loot like books and enchanted books.
Spiral Staircase

Often leads into the stronghold.
Storerooms

Contain loot like bread, apples, coal, iron, gold, and redstone.
Altar Corridors

Have chests with valuable loot—sometimes diamonds, enchanted books, or rare items.
Other room

empty rooms, cells, five-way intersections, and staircases.
Mobs and Hazards
Expect zombies, skeletons, and other hostile mobs in dark corridors. Use torches to keep areas safe.

Beware of Silverfish—tiny mobs hiding in infested stone bricks. Mining these blocks or not killing one quickly may cause a swarm. The silverfish spawner is located in the End portal room. It’s best to destroy it quickly.
Strongholds can intersect with caves, ravines, or underwater areas, which may cause broken or unusual layouts. Check behind walls or stairs for hidden corridors or rooms.
The End Portal Room
The End portal room contains the End portal frame, a silverfish spawner, and usually lava.

In some versions, the portal room may not generate correctly. However, newer versions usually guarantee the portal room’s presence.
End Portal Activation
Be cautious of lava under the frame—use a water bucket to turn it into obsidian and make the area safe.
Preparation for the Stronghold and The End
Bring these items before entering the stronghold or The End
Armor & Weapons

Diamond or Netherite armor, a good pickaxe, sword, and bow.
Food


Lots of food like Golden Carrots or Golden Apples.
Eyes of Ender

Bring at least 12 (plus extras).
Torches

To light corridors and mark your path.
Bed

Place one above ground near the stronghold to set your spawn.
Water Bucket

For lava, falling, and Endermen.
Building Blocks

To bridge or block off areas.
Potions




Slow Falling, Healing, Regeneration, Strength.
Carved Pumpkin

Wear one to avoid provoking Endermen in The End.

Frequently Asked Questions(FAQs)
🍄Can Silverfish spawn in Strongholds?
Yes—Silverfish spawner is found in the portal room. Be ready for a quick fight.
🍄Do Strongholds have villagers or beds?
No—these are abandoned structures with no natural respawn point.
🍄What Y-level is the Stronghold at?
Usually between Y=0 and Y=-20, but it varies—always dig carefully to avoid lava or caves.
